Strong-motion duration and response scaling of yielding and degrading eccentric structures

Christian Malaga-Chuquitaype

Summary: This paper examines the seismic response scaling of degrading and non-degrading eccentric structures subjected to bidirectional earthquake action, finding that the duration of ground motion plays a fundamental role in defining the peak displacement response of structures. The study also highlights the significant impact of degradation on the structural response, as well as the emergence of self-similar response when orientationally consistent dimensionless parameters are selected.
